#f16427 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f16427 is composed of 94.5% red, 39.2%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 83.8%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 54.9%. #f16427 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c84e with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f16427 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f16427 has RGB values of R:241, G:100,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.84,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15819815.

Shades and Tints of #f16427
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050200 is the darkest color, while #fef5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f16427
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908b88 is the less saturated color, while #fa601e is the most saturated one.
